How much do part time salesforce marketing cloud j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 4, 2026, the average yearly pay for part time salesforce marketing cloud in the United States is $98,862.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$75,500.00 and $119,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a part time Salesforce Marketing Cloud specialist?

A Part Time Salesforce Marketing Cloud specialist is a professional who works on a flexible or reduced schedule to manage and execute marketing campaigns using Salesforce Marketing Cloud. Their responsibilities typically include creating email journeys, managing subscriber lists, analyzing campaign performance, and automating marketing communications. By working part time, they offer companies expertise in digital marketing and Salesforce tools without the commitment of a full-time hire. This role is ideal for organizations needing specialized skills for specific projects or ongoing support on a limited basis.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a part time Salesforce Marketing Cloud specialist?

To thrive as a Part Time Salesforce Marketing Cloud Specialist, you need experience with digital marketing concepts, email campaign management, and a solid understanding of Salesforce Marketing Cloud features, often supported by relevant certifications. Proficiency in Marketing Cloud tools such as Email Studio, Journey Builder, and Automation Studio, as well as familiarity with SQL and AMPscript, is typically required. Strong communication, problem-solving skills, and the ability to manage multiple projects independently help you excel in this flexible role. These skills ensure effective campaign execution, seamless collaboration, and measurable marketing outcomes in a dynamic, part-time work environment.

What are some common challenges faced by part time Salesforce Marketing Cloud professionals, and how can they be managed?

Part-time Salesforce Marketing Cloud professionals often face challenges in staying aligned with rapidly changing campaign requirements and team communications due to limited working hours. To manage this, it's helpful to establish clear communication channels and utilize project management tools to track updates and deliverables. Regular check-ins with full-time team members and thorough documentation of all campaign activities can also help ensure smooth collaboration and continuity. Being proactive in seeking updates and clarifications can make a significant difference in successfully managing part-time responsibilities.

Job description

Student Marketing Analyst Specialist
We are seeking a data-driven Student Assistant, Marketing Analyst Specialist to join our marketing data analytics team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for collecting, analyzing, and interpreting marketing data to inform strategic decision-making and optimize digital environments and marketing campaigns. As a key member of the Data, Analytics, and Insights (DAI) team, you will collaborate with other team members to align our efforts with business objectives and deliver value to our stakeholders. The Marketing Analyst Specialist will play a crucial role in measuring marketing performance, identifying trends, and uncovering actionable insights to drive business growth.
This position will require approximately 20 hours per week.
What you'll do
  • Data collection and analysis: Collect and analyze marketing data from various sources, including website analytics, search engine optimization, social media, communications, paid media, and CRM systems.
  • Performance measurement: Track and measure the effectiveness of marketing campaigns and digital environments, including ROI, conversion rates, and other key performance indicators (KPIs).
  • Reporting and insights: Develop comprehensive reports and presentations that summarize marketing performance, highlight key trends, and provide actionable recommendations to improve effectiveness of campaigns and digital environments.
  • Campaign optimization: Collaborate with marketing team members to optimize marketing campaigns based on data-driven insights.
  • A/B testing analysis: Evaluate A/B tests to measure effectiveness of different marketing strategies and tactics.
  • Data visualization: Create visually appealing dashboards and reports to communicate complex data insights to stakeholders.

What you'll need
  • Familiarity with quantitative analysis
  • Familiarity with qualitative analysis
  • Strong problem-solving skills and ability to learn new concepts and technologies quickly
  • Familiar with concepts related to website performance, search engine optimization, and communications
  • Strong leadership, communication, and collaboration skills.
  • Passion for innovation and commitment to continuous learning

Relevant qualifications
  • Currently pursuing a degree (Bachelor's, Master's, or Graduate) in marketing analytics or related program at ASU.

Preferred education and experience
  • Minimum of 1+ years in marketing analytics
  • Completed relevant coursework in areas such as website analytics, search engine marketing and optimization, strategic communications, or related disciplines
  • Certified in Google Analytics
  • Demonstrate experience in data analytics

Preferred skills and abilities
  • Google Analytics, Google Tag Manager, Google Search Console, Optimizely, Salesforce Marketing Cloud
